got a few SSDs.

main PC - Samsung 830 256GB
backup PC - OCZ Vertex 2e 120GB
laptop - Kingston HyperX (original 5K version) 128GB

the laptop is quite old but it was the right price (free), intel T9300 2.5GHz dual core. despite only having SATA I (read performance cut in half), the kingston drive turned the old slug into something very capable.
